Why a Shed for My Lawn Mower Is Necessary

I’ve found that having a shed for my lawn mower is one of the best ways to protect my equipment and keep it working longer. When I leave my mower outside, it gets exposed to rain, sun, dust, and moisture, which can cause rust, wear, and damage over time. Storing it in a shed helps me keep it dry and in better condition, so I don’t have to deal with unnecessary repairs as often.

Another reason I like keeping my lawn mower in a shed is convenience. My mower, fuel, oil, and other gardening tools all stay in one place, so I can find everything quickly when I need it. It also keeps my yard looking cleaner and more organized, instead of leaving equipment scattered around.

For me, a shed also adds a layer of safety and security. It helps keep the mower away from children, pets, and theft. Overall, having a shed gives me peace of mind, protects my investment, and makes lawn care much easier.

My Buying Guides on Shed For Lawn Mower

Why I Think a Lawn Mower Shed Matters

When I started looking for a shed for my lawn mower, I realized it was about more than just storage. I wanted a space that would protect my mower from rain, sun, dust, and rust. A good shed also keeps my yard organized and makes it easier for me to grab the mower whenever I need it.

My First Step: Measuring the Space

Before buying anything, I measured both my mower and the area where I wanted to place the shed. I learned quickly that I needed extra room, not just for the mower itself, but also for walking around it and storing accessories like fuel cans, trimmers, and tools. I always recommend checking the mower’s height, width, and length carefully.

Choosing the Right Size

I found that size is one of the most important things to consider. If the shed is too small, it becomes frustrating to use. If it is too large, it may waste space and cost more than necessary. I looked for a shed that gave me enough room for easy parking and a little extra storage.

Material Matters to Me

I compared wood, metal, and resin sheds before deciding what worked best for my needs.

  • Wood: I like the natural look, and it blends well with my yard, but it needs more maintenance.
  • Metal: I found it durable and secure, though it can get hot and may rust if not treated well.
  • Resin/Plastic: This seemed low-maintenance and weather-resistant, which made it very appealing to me.

Weather Protection Is a Must

I wanted a shed that could stand up to my local weather. If you live in a rainy area like I do, make sure the shed has a strong roof and proper sealing. If your summers are hot, ventilation is also important so the mower and fuel don’t get damaged by heat buildup.

Door Style and Access

I paid close attention to the door design because I didn’t want to struggle every time I moved the mower in or out. Wide double doors or a ramp made a big difference for me. I also made sure the opening was tall enough for my mower, especially if it had a grass catcher attached.

Security Features I Look For

If I’m storing expensive equipment, I want some level of security. I looked for sheds with lockable doors and sturdy construction. Even a simple padlock option gave me peace of mind.

Ventilation and Moisture Control

I learned that poor airflow can lead to moisture buildup, mold, and rust. That’s why I prefer a shed with vents or windows. Good ventilation helps keep the mower dry and in better condition over time.

Assembly and Maintenance

I also think about how easy the shed is to assemble. Some sheds are simple to put together, while others require more time and tools. I prefer a shed that doesn’t turn into a weekend-long project. Maintenance matters too, because I want something I can clean and care for without much trouble.

My Budget Considerations

I always balance price with quality. A cheaper shed may save money upfront, but I’ve found that spending a little more often means better durability and fewer problems later. I look at the shed as a long-term investment in protecting my mower.
